Output 09e7a9da370088c763aa026936adbadbebad401c7c3833c5596f1ba1e56b1f56:7

value
1955849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8d98f61d442b080e4e9b2052dd118b538050cd5 OP_EQUAL
address
3MTcWKTB51jh6kQ735H8ZuzsoqANxn2e6s
transaction
09e7a9da370088c763aa026936adbadbebad401c7c3833c5596f1ba1e56b1f56
spent
true